如何在ASP中使用MDB数据库连接? (asp mdb数据库连接)
在网络开发中,使用数据库是一个很常见的需求。MDB是Access数据库的一种类型,它可以轻松地存储和管理数据并与其他应用程序实现数据交换。在ASP开发中,使用MDB数据库连接也是非常常见的需求。在本文中,我们将探讨如何在ASP中使用MDB数据库连接。
步骤一:创建一个数据源
需要在本地或远程创建一个MDB数据库。在Access中可以轻松地创建一个MDB数据库。可以使用“新建”菜单中的“空白数据库”选项来创建一个空白的数据库。然后请将其保存在希望团队能够访问的位置。
步骤二:配置数据源名
接下来,在计算机的“管理工具”中的“ODBC数据源”应用程序中创建一个数据源。为此,请按照以下步骤操作:
1. 在“ODBC数据源”窗口上选择“用户DSN”选项卡。
2. 单击“添加”按钮以打开“创建新的数据源”对话框。
3. 在“选择驱动程序”页面上选择“Microsoft Access驱动程序(*.mdb)”,然后单击“完成”按钮。
4. 在“创建数据源”对话框中,在“数据源名称”字段中键入一个名称。这个名称将是一个备用名称,我们后面需要使用它来访问数据源。
5. 在“描述”字段中键入一个描述,指明该数据源的用途。
6. 在“数据库”字段中输入数据库的实际路径和名称(完整的路径和名称)。
7. 单击“测试连接”按钮,以确保连接已经建立。
步骤三:创建ASP文件并连接数据库
一旦完成了数据源的配置,就可以开始编写ASP文件并访问数据源了。在ASP文件中,需要使用ADO对象模型连接到数据库。ADO(ActiveX数据对象)是用于数据库访问的编程接口。接下来,我们将看到如何使用ASP来连接到数据源。
1. 使用代码块包裹以下代码,创建一个ADO连接对象,并使用数据源名称来打开数据源:
“`
<%
Dim objConn
Set objConn = Server.CreateObject(“ADODB.Connection”)
objConn.Open “DSN=AppName;”
%>
“`
2. 然后,可以在ASP代码中使用SQL查询语句,从数据库中获取数据,如下所示:
“`
<%
Dim objRS
Dim strSQL
strSQL = “SELECT * FROM Customers”
Set objRS = Server.CreateObject(“ADODB.Recordset”)
objRS.Open strSQL, objConn
Do While Not objRS.EOF
Response.Write(objRS(“CustomerID”) & ” | ” & objRS(“CompanyName”) & “
“)
objRS.MoveNext
Loop
objRS.Close
Set objRS = Nothing
objConn.Close
Set objConn = Nothing
%>
“`
在这篇文章中,我们学习了如何在ASP中使用MDB数据库连接。首先需要创建一个数据源,并使用ODBC管理工具配置其名称。然后,使用ASP代码创建ADO连接对象,并打开数据源。使用SQL查询语句从数据库中获取数据,并将其显示在浏览器中。掌握这些技能可以为您的ASP应用程序提供更强大的功能,以更高效地处理和管理数据。